Abstract

711,911. Making sliding clasp fasteners. TALON, Inc. Oct. 26, 1951 [Nov. 17, 1950], No. 25083/51. Classes 83 (2) and 83 (4). [Also in Group XXV] A machine for making slide fastener stringers comprises a reciprocable slide carrying a forming die, means for cutting fastener element blanks successively from the end of a continuous length of stock and positioning them in said die, and means co-operating with said die to shape said blanks so as to provide formed fastener elements, said slide upon movement in one direction positioning a formed fastener element astride a flexible carrier positioned opposite said slide, and upon movement in the opposite direction cooperating with said cutting means to cut and position a fastener element blank in said die. Wire W of substantially Y-shaped cross-section is fed upwardly by friction rollers 2, 3, through the reciprocable slide 4 which carries the forming die 10, to abut a guide block 8. Movement of the slide to the right, Fig. 3, causes a blank to be sheared from the end of the stock by a knife 9, continued movement of the slide positioning the blank in the die beneath a forming punch 14. The blank is substantially surrounded during the punching operation to confine flow of metal by the knife 9, upstanding portions 16 of the die, and a finger-like member 21 which moves with the punch and extends between the legs of the blank and the portions 16. The punch and member 21 are carried in a block 35 vertically slidable on a block 36, and are moved downwardly to effect the forming of the blank by a punch 43 adjustably mounted in a head 41 which is slidably mounted on guide posts 42 and actuated by a crank 54 from a drive shaft 56 with a handwheel 57 and pulley or sprocket 58 at opposite ends. The head 41 comprises also a cam portion 50 which engages rollers 52 in a slot 51 in the slide 4 to actuate said slide. On the return movement of the slide, to the left as shown in Fig. 3, the legs of the formed fastener element are positioned astride the corded edge of a stringer tape T which passes through a guide 23, spring urged towards the slide so as to maintain the edge of the tape in a slot 19 in the end of the slide. Tools 25, 26, Fig. 4, carried by the slide are actuated through racks 31, 32 fixed to the machine base on each side of the slide, to clamp the element around the tape on forward movement of the slide, the wire W being simultaneously fed upwardly into position ready for the cutting of another blank on return movement of the slide, Figs. 13, 14. The tape T passes upwardly between a roller 60 driven, through a ratchet wheel 67 on its shaft 62 from the drive shaft 56, and a roller '61 geared to the roller 60 through gear wheels 65, 66, the roller 61 being supported by a pivoted bracket 76 spring urged toward the roller 60. In a modification, Fig. 15 (not shown), the slide is double acting to make a fastener stringer at each end, and operated by an eccentric on a shaft positioned in an opening centrally of the slide. In a further modification, Fig. 17, two double acting slides 200, 201, are actuated by an oscillating shaft 222, to make four stringers at one time.
